Abstract
Corn starch was esterified with octenyl succinic anhydride (OSA), in which semidry method assisted with vacuum-microwave treatment was used under the alkalescent condition. The effect of vacuum treatment on esterification was studied. The products were characterized by Fourier transform infrared (FT-IR) spectroscopy, 1H n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R), scanning electron microscopy (SEM) and X-ray diffraction.
